Cleophas Ng’etich and Sheila Chepkurui braved the rain and difficult conditions to emerge victorious in the second round of the Athletics Kenya National Cross Country Series.
The Kapsabet based Ng’etich finished the senior men’s 10km race in a time of 30 minutes 4.09 seconds, six seconds clear of Thika’s Stephen Arita who clocked a time of 30:10.09.
Nakuru’s Bernard Kipkemboi posted 30:19.7 to claim the third position while the Nyahururu duo of Peter Wambua and Cornelius Kosgey claimed the fourth and fifth positions with Laikipia;s Franklin Ngereri rounding off the top six in 30:26.8.
The top three in the senior women’s race ran over the same distance saw Chepkurui just nick it, her time of 33:47.9 barely two seconds ahead of Prison’s Nancy Nzisa who clocked 33:49.2 with Nakuru’s Njoki Ndung’u settling for third in 33:51.6
The experienced Veronica Nyaruai finished fourth in 34 minutes 2 second ahead of the Prisons duo of Eunice Kioko and Miriam Muthoni who rounded off the top six.
Mfae’s Cyrus Loikong and Cecelia Maria of Machakos were victorious in the junior men’s and women’s categories respectively.
Loikong posted a time of 24:02.8 to win the junior men’s race run over 8km while Maira posted 21:32.8 to win the junior women’s race run over 6km.
